Leslie v. State

Opinion
Conviction in District Court of Nacogdoches County of theft from the person, punishment two years in the penitentiary.
The record is before us without any statement of facts or bills of exception. The indictment in this case charges the offense in accordance with the statute, and the instructions given by the court are pertinent and present the law.
No error appearing, the judgment will be affirmed.
Affirmed.
Morrow, P. J., absent.
